facebook -parental-controls-guide”>Facebook is one of the most popular social media platforms in the world, with over 2.8 billion active users as of 2021. With such a massive user base, it’s natural for people to be curious about who views their profiles. After all, we all want to know who is interested in our lives and what we share on social media. However, the question remains, is it possible to tell who views your Facebook profile?

The short answer is no. Facebook does not provide a feature that allows users to see who viewed their profile. This is due to privacy reasons and to protect the user’s data. However, there are a few methods that some people claim can help you determine who views your Facebook profile. In this article, we will explore these methods and give you the facts so you can decide for yourself if it’s possible to tell who views your Facebook profile.

Method #1: Facebook Profile Views Data

One of the methods that claim to show who views your Facebook profile is by using a third-party app that collects and analyzes data from your Facebook profile. These apps claim to show you a list of people who have recently viewed your profile. However, these apps are not endorsed by Facebook, and there is no evidence to suggest that they actually work.

In fact, Facebook has released a statement warning users about these apps, stating that they do not have access to the information needed to create such a list. These apps only have access to your public information, such as your name, profile picture, and cover photo. They cannot access any data that is hidden from the public, such as your posts, comments, or private messages. This means that even if these apps show you a list of people who have recently viewed your profile, it’s not accurate information.

Moreover, these apps can also pose a security risk as they require you to grant them access to your Facebook account. This gives them the ability to post on your behalf, view your private information, and even send messages to your friends without your consent. Therefore, it’s always best to avoid using such third-party apps and stick to the features provided by Facebook.

Method #5: Facebook Insights

If you have a Facebook Page, you may have access to Facebook Insights, which provides you with data and analytics about your page’s performance. Some people believe that by analyzing this data, you can determine who views your Facebook profile.

However, Facebook Insights only show you data related to your page and not your individual profile. This means that you cannot use this feature to determine who views your personal profile.
